About E. A. Soluyanova
E. A. Soluyanova is a scholar working on Aerospace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Control and Systems Engineering, having authored 35 papers that have together received 399 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gyrotron and Vacuum Electronics Research (34 papers), Particle accelerators and beam dynamics (27 papers) and Pulsed Power Technology Applications (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(385 citations), Control and Systems Engineering (181 citations) and Aerospace Engineering (187 citations). E. A. Soluyanova has collaborated with scholars based in Russia and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Г. Г. Денисов, E. M. Tai, A. V. Chirkov, Г. Г. Денисов, A. A. Bogdashov, V. E. Zapevalov, V. I. Malygin, E.M. Tai, S. V. Mishakin and С. В. Самсонов.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, IEEE Transactions on Electron Devices and Review of Scientific Instruments.
